Subject: Re: INFO: task kjournal:337 blocked for more than 120 seconds
Date: Thu, 01 Oct 2009 14:00:20 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1254430820.5033.4.camel@localhost.localdomain>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1254416336.6787.6.camel@localhost.localdomain>
I talked to Mingming, she suggested to use different IO scheduler. The
default scheduler is cfg, after I switch to noop, the problem is gone.
So there seems a bug in cfg scheduler. It's easily reproduced it when
running the guest kernel, so far I haven't hit this problem on the host
side.
